The International Theatre Project aims to support inclusivity, education, and creativity in communities all around the world through the creation of theatre. They host several programs designed around the specific needs of young people around the world. These could be great opportunities for young leaders who would like to bring theatre into their communities OR for creative young people looking to lend their talents to a large international project.
Their main programs include Rising Voices, in which people from disadvantaged areas can perform theatre in and for their communities; Open Doors, a program specifically for immigrant communities in the United States; and the Stefan Nowicki that awards kids from Rwanda and South Africa a chance to attend summer theatre camp in the United States.
